AE11 FCU is a 2011 Skoda Octavia in Silver with a 1,598cc diesel engine. This vehicle has been through 19 MOT tests with a personal pass rate of 68.4%.
Across all 2011 Skoda Octavia models, the average MOT pass rate is 79.1% with a typical mileage of 83,226 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Skoda Octavia f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 81,688 recorded failures. If you're considering buying AE11 FCU, it's worth having these areas checked by a mechanic before committing.
The Skoda Octavia typically stays on UK roads for around 28 years. At 15 years old, this Skoda Octavia is well into its expected lifespan but still has years ahead.
